In a bold stride toward youth empowerment and community development, Hon. Engr. Dominic Okafor, the honorable member representing Aguata Federal Constituency, Anambra State, has officially facilitated the construction of a state-of-the-art Skill Acquisition and Indoor Sports Multi-Purpose Complex in Obuino, Igbo-Ukwu.
The transformative project, commissioned through the National Productivity Centre, an agency under the Tinubu-led Federal Government, is set to be a game-changer. Designed to feature a skills acquisition centre, indoor badminton courts, table tennis, drafts, ludo, and two world-class standard sports arenas, the facility will not only empower youths with vocational training but also serve as a vibrant recreational hub for all members of the community.
“This project is more than concrete and steel, it’s about building lives,” said Engr. Innocent Azil, one of the project contractors, who lauded Hon. Okafor’s visionary leadership.
Strategically located on a major accessible road, the complex is expected to draw visitors from all 20 wards and 14 communities of Aguata, including Igbo-Ukwu, Ekwulobia, Ikenga, Isuofia, Umuona, Umuchu, Achina, Akpo, Ezi Ihite, and Uga.
Hon. Okafor expressed deep appreciation to Rt. Hon. Speaker Tajudeen Abbas, PhD, GCON, describing him as a “people’s speaker — caring, outspoken, and God-sent.” He acknowledged the Speaker’s critical role in facilitating federal support that made the project possible through the appropriate agency.
Set for completion and commissioning in 2026, the complex stands as a beacon of hope, expected to curb youth involvement in crime, counter rural-urban migration, and rekindle a sense of pride and unity across the constituency.
